技术深度解析
这场冲突的核心在于Claude Code与GitHub Copilot之间根本性的架构差异。Claude Code基于Anthropic的Claude 3.5 Sonnet和即将推出的Claude 4模型,采用链式思维推理架构,将复杂编程任务分解为中间步骤。这使得它能够以Copilot的下一词预测范式难以企及的连贯性处理多文件重构、依赖解析和测试生成。具体而言,Claude Code的代理循环——它可以读取文件、执行命令并迭代自身输出——使其在自主开发场景中拥有显著优势。
相比之下,GitHub Copilot由OpenAI的GPT-4o及其微调变体Codex驱动。其优势在于实时内联补全和快速代码片段生成,但代理能力较为有限。Copilot的架构依赖于无状态的提示-响应循环,而Claude Code则维护一个持久上下文窗口(高达20万token),使其能够跨会话“记住”整个项目结构。
基准测试对比表:
| 基准测试 | Claude Code (Claude 3.5 Sonnet) | GitHub Copilot (GPT-4o) | 差异 |
|---|---|---|---|
| HumanEval (Pass@1) | 92.0% | 90.2% | Claude领先1.8% |
| SWE-bench Verified (已解决) | 49.3% | 38.8% | Claude领先10.5% |
| 多文件重构 (准确率) | 87% | 71% | Claude领先16% |
| 代理任务完成度 (自主) | 73% | 52% | Claude领先21% |
| 平均延迟 (每次请求) | 1.8秒 | 0.9秒 | Copilot快2倍 |
数据要点: Claude Code在复杂、多步骤任务和自主编码方面占据主导地位,而Copilot在简单补全方面保持速度优势。随着Anthropic在推理改进方面的投入,这一差距正在扩大。
该领域一个值得注意的开源项目是Continue.dev(GitHub: continuedev/continue,25k+星标),它提供了一个开源AI代码助手,可接入任何LLM后端。随着开发者寻求平台锁定工具的替代方案,该项目关注度激增。另一个是TabbyML(GitHub: TabbyML/tabby,25k+星标),一个自托管代码补全服务器,提供隐私和云提供商独立性。
关键参与者与案例研究
主要参与者是微软(通过GitHub Copilot)和Anthropic(通过Claude Code)。但涟漪效应波及整个AI基础设施层。
微软的战略: 微软正在利用其Azure云垄断地位。通过撤销Claude Code许可证,它实际上是在阻止直接竞争对手接触其最有利可图的企业客户群。这与其历史上“拥抱、扩展、消灭”的策略如出一辙,如今被应用于AI工具。微软还向OpenAI投资了130亿美元,从而获得GPT模型的优先访问权,并确保Copilot与Azure DevOps、Visual Studio和GitHub Actions紧密集成。
Anthropic的困境: Anthropic将自己定位为“安全优先”的替代方案,但缺乏自己的云基础设施。它依赖AWS(已投资40亿美元)和Azure进行计算。这种依赖性使其易受攻击。Anthropic的回应是加速在AWS Bedrock和Google Cloud上部署自己的模型,但失去Azure访问权限造成的损失是巨大的。
竞品对比:
| 特性 | GitHub Copilot | Claude Code | Amazon CodeWhisperer |
|---|---|---|---|
| 底层模型 | GPT-4o (OpenAI) | Claude 3.5/4 (Anthropic) | Titan (Amazon) |
| 代理能力 | 有限 | 高级 (多步骤) | 基础 |
| 上下文窗口 | 128K tokens | 200K tokens | 8K tokens |
| Azure集成 | 原生 | 已封锁 | 无 |
| 定价 (企业版) | 39美元/用户/月 | 30美元/用户/月 | 19美元/用户/月 |
| 开源替代方案 | 无 | 无 | 无 (但AWS Bedrock支持自带模型) |
数据要点: Claude Code提供最佳性能和上下文,但Copilot的Azure锁定使其拥有无可匹敌的分发优势。Amazon CodeWhisperer更便宜,但技术上处于劣势。
行业影响与市场动态
此举将加速AI编程工具市场的两极分化。一方面,平台集成工具(Copilot、CodeWhisperer)将在各自云生态内占据主导。另一方面,独立工具(Claude Code、Cursor、Continue)将争夺多云和开源开发者细分市场。
市场份额估算(2025年第一季度):
| 工具 | 市场份额 (收入) | 增长率 (同比) | 主要平台 |
|---|---|---|---|
| GitHub Copilot | 62% | +45% | Azure/GitHub |
| Amazon CodeWhisperer | 18% | +60% | AWS |
| Claude Code | 12% | +120% | 多云 |
| 其他 (Cursor、Tabnine等) | 8% | +30% | 多种 |
数据要点: Claude Code是增长最快的工具,但微软的许可封锁可能将其市场份额增长限制在15-18%,除非Anthropic能够确保中立的发行渠道。